What is Pantaya
Overview
Pantaya is a subscription-based streaming service focused on Spanish-language films and series. It offers a catalogue of high-quality titles and some exclusive original content.
Who it serves
Pantaya targets viewers who prefer Spanish-language entertainment, including films, series and curated collections. It is available on multiple platforms including web, iOS and Android.
How to cancel Pantaya
Cancel via website (recommended)
- Sign in to your Pantaya account on the official site.
- Go to Account or Subscription settings and select Cancel subscription.
- Follow on-screen prompts to confirm cancellation; website cancellations typically stop future billing immediately.
Cancel via app stores
- iOS (App Store): Manage and cancel through your Apple ID Subscriptions settings; cancellation must be done in Apple’s subscription management, not within the Pantaya app.
- Android (Google Play): Manage and cancel via your Google Play account > Subscriptions section.
What happens when you cancel
Access after cancellation
When you cancel via the website, most accounts retain access until the end of the paid period unless the site specifies immediate termination.
When you cancel through App Store or Google Play, access generally continues until the current billing period ends per the store’s policies.
Renewal and data
Cancellation prevents future automatic renewals. Your account data (watchlist, preferences) may be retained according to Pantaya’s data policy.
If you later re-subscribe, saved preferences may be restored, but this depends on Pantaya’s account retention rules.

Common mistakes
Assuming app cancellation is enough
Many users cancel inside the Pantaya app but forget subscriptions are managed through App Store or Google Play. This can lead to unexpected charges.
Always confirm which platform billed you and cancel in that platform when applicable.
Missing proof of cancellation
Not saving confirmation emails or screenshots can make disputes harder to resolve. Always capture cancellation confirmations and payment records.
